The Need for Ceremony in the Digital Rights and Advocacy Movement

Introduction: The digital age has revolutionized the way we live, work, and communicate. However, along with the numerous benefits come challenges related to privacy, free expression, and internet governance. In order to address these issues, the digital rights and advocacy movement has emerged, advocating for a more open, secure, and equal digital landscape. In this blog post, we explore the importance of ceremony in the digital rights and advocacy movement and how it can shape a better future for all. 1. Defining Digital Rights and Advocacy: Digital rights refer to the fundamental rights and freedoms that individuals possess in relation to the use of digital technologies. This includes the right to privacy, freedom of expression, access to information, and protection against online surveillance. Advocacy, on the other hand, involves actively promoting and defending these rights through various means, such as campaigning, raising awareness, and engaging with policymakers. 2. The Role of Ceremony: Ceremony, in the context of the digital rights and advocacy movement, refers to the formalities and rituals that help solidify the values, principles, and goals of the movement. It is a way to create a sense of community, instill trust, and inspire action. Ceremonies can take various forms, such as conferences, workshops, online campaigns, and public demonstrations. 3. Building Trust and Collaboration: Ceremonies provide a platform for like-minded individuals, organizations, and communities to come together, share insights, and collaborate on strategies to protect digital rights. By creating a space for open dialogue, these ceremonies foster trust and build stronger networks that can amplify the movement's collective voice. Additionally, they offer opportunities for knowledge exchange, capacity building, and the formation of coalitions for more effective advocacy. 4. Raising Awareness and Mobilizing Action: Ceremonies serve as catalysts for raising awareness about digital rights and the importance of advocacy. Through panel discussions, keynote speeches, and interactive sessions, these events educate attendees on the current challenges and proposed solutions. They also empower individuals to take action by providing them with tools, resources, and action plans to engage in advocacy efforts. Ceremonies can inspire a sense of urgency and motivate participants to make a positive impact in their communities and beyond. 5. Influencing Policy and Legislation: One of the primary goals of the digital rights and advocacy movement is to influence policy and legislation to protect and promote digital rights. Ceremonies play a crucial role in engaging with policymakers, lawmakers, and regulatory bodies. By providing a platform for constructive dialogue, showcasing evidence-based research, and highlighting the real-life impact of inadequate regulations, ceremonies can help shape policies that prioritize digital rights and protect vulnerable individuals and communities. 6. Empowering Individuals: Ceremonies not only empower individuals to participate in advocacy efforts but also help them understand their rights and responsibilities in the digital realm. Through workshops, training sessions, and skill-sharing activities, ceremonies equip individuals with the necessary knowledge and tools to safeguard their online privacy, promote digital literacy, and navigate digital platforms safely. Conclusion: The digital rights and advocacy movement is crucial in today's increasingly connected world. Ceremonies play a significant role in fostering trust, building collaborations, raising awareness, mobilizing action, and influencing policy changes. By actively participating in these ceremonies and supporting the movement, individuals and communities can contribute to a more inclusive, free, and secure digital environment for all. Let us embrace the power of ceremony to shape a better future for digital rights and advocate for a more just and equitable world online.
